You might try posting in Research. Since scientific understanding changes over time, i might be a good ideas to look for online resources. National Geographic has pages on most animals. You may also want to contact wildlife experts or zoos in areas where beavers are endemic. Usually, experts are happy to speak with writers because they want us to have the facts correct as well.
